Innholdsfortegnelse
Mens du jobber med ustrukturerte rådata, kan det hende du ofte trenger å trekke ut relevant informasjon fra dem. Noen ganger må du fjerne første, andre eller tredje tegn fra tekststrengen for å hente verdien. Excel har noen funksjoner som du kan gjøre den typen oppgaver med. Du kan også lage din egendefinerte funksjon for å fjerne tegn fra tekststrenger også. I dag i denne artikkelen vil vi diskutere hvordan du fjerner de 3 første tegnene i Excel.
Last ned øvelsesarbeidsbok
Last ned denne øvelsesboken for å utføre oppgaven mens du leser denne artikkelen.
Fjern de tre første tegnene.xlsm
4 passende måter å fjerne de tre første tegnene i Excel
Vurder en situasjon der du har en database som inneholder rådata. De første 3 tegnene i alle dataene dine er unødvendige, og nå må du fjerne disse tegnene. I denne delen vil vi vise hvordan du fjerner de tre første tegnene fra dataene dine i Excel.
1. Bruk HØYRE funksjon for å fjerne de tre første tegnene i Excel
Kombinasjonen av HØYRE-funksjonen og LEN-funksjonen kan hjelpe deg med å fjerne de tre første tegnene fra datacellene dine. Denne metoden er beskrevet i trinnene nedenfor.
Trinn 1:
- I celle C4 bruker du HØYRE funksjonen nestet med LEN Formelen er
=RIGHT(B4,LEN(B4)-3)
- Her, streng_celle er B4 hvorfra vi vil fjerne 3 tegn.
- LEN(B4)-3 brukes som antall_tegn . LEN -funksjonen vil sørge for å fjerne de første 3 tegnene fra cellen.
Trinn 2:
- Nå som formelen vår er klar, trykk ENTER for å få resultatet.
- Vårt resultatet er her. For å få hele resultatet, flytt musepekeren til nedre høyre hjørne av cellen. Når markøren viser krysstegnet, dobbeltklikker du på tegnet for å bruke samme funksjon på resten av cellene.
Relatert innhold: Hvordan fjerne det første tegnet fra en streng i Excel med VBA
2. Bruk REPLACE-funksjonen for å fjerne de første 3 tegnene i Excel
REPLACE-funksjonen erstatter vanligvis deler av en tekststreng med en annen tekststreng. Men i denne delen vil vi bruke denne funksjonen til å fjerne tegn fra celler. La oss se hvordan det gjøres.
Trinn 1:
- Bruk ERSTATT -funksjonen i celle C4 . Formelen er,
=REPLACE(B4,1,3,"")
- Hvor B4 er den gamle teksten.
- Startnummer er 1. Vi starter fra begynnelsen.
- Antall_tegn er 3 da vi ønsker å erstatte de tre første tegnene.
- Ny_tekst er den endrede teksten som vil erstatte den gamle teksten.
- ENTER for å få deresultat. Fra resultatet kan vi se at formelen vår fungerer perfekt.
- Nå vil vi bruke den samme formelen på alle nødvendige celler.
Les mer: Fjern siste tegn fra streng Excel (5 enkle metoder)
Lignende avlesninger:
- VBA for å fjerne tegn fra streng i Excel (7 metoder)
- Hvordan fjerne ikke-utskrivbare tegn i Excel (4 enkle måter)
- Fjern tomme tegn i Excel (5 metoder)
- Slik fjerner du enkle sitater i Excel (6 måter)
- Hvordan fjerne semikolon i Excel (4 metoder)
3. Sett inn MID-funksjonen for å fjerne de første 3 tegnene i Excel
Kombinasjonen av MID-funksjonen og LEN-funksjonen gjør samme operasjon som metode én. Vi vil nå bruke denne formelen på datasettet vårt.
Trinn 1:
- Formelen som vi vil bruke i celle C4 er ,
=MID(B4,4,LEN(B4)-3)
- Her tekst er B4
- Start_tall er 4 da vi fjerner de 3 første tallene.
- Antall_tegn er definert som LEN(B4)-3)
- Trykk ENTER og bruk formelen på alle celler. Jobben vår her er gjort!
Les mer: Hvordan fjerne tegn fra streng i Excel (14 måter)
4. Introduser en brukerdefinert funksjon for å fjerne de første 3 tegnene i Excel
Du kanlag også en egen funksjon for å fullføre denne oppgaven. Det stemmer, du kan definere en egendefinert funksjon for å gjøre jobben din. Du må skrive en VBA-kode for å gjøre det. Vi vil diskutere denne prosessen ved å bruke trinnene nedenfor. For å vite mer om skreddersydde funksjoner, Klikk her!
Trinn 1:
- Gå først til Microsoft Visual Basic for Applications-vinduet ved å trykke Alt+F11 .
- En ny vinduet åpnes. Klikk nå Sett inn og velg Modul for å åpne en ny modul.
Trinn 2:
- I den nyåpnede modulen, Sett inn VBA-koden for å lage en UFD for å fjerne de første 3 tegnene fra cellene dine. Vi har gitt koden for deg. Du kan bare kopiere denne koden og bruke den i regnearket ditt. Navnet på vår brukerdefinerte funksjon er RemoveFirst3 . Og koden for å lage denne funksjonen er,
2571
Trinn 3:
- Koden vår er skrevet . Gå nå tilbake til regnearket og skriv inn funksjonen =RemoveFirst3 . Vi kan se at funksjonen er opprettet.
- Bruk nå funksjonen i celle C4 . Funksjonen er
=RemoveFirst3(B4,3)
- Trykk ENTER for å få resultatet.
- Vår skreddersydde funksjon fungerer som den skal. Vi vil nå bruke denne funksjonen på resten av cellene for å få finalenresultat.
Relatert innhold: Slik fjerner du de siste 3 tegnene i Excel (4 formler)
Ting å Husk
👉 Å lage en egendefinert formel har flere begrensninger enn vanlige VBA-makroer. Den kan ikke endre strukturen eller formatet til et regneark eller en celle.
👉 Ved å bruke UFD, kan du fjerne N antall tegn fra cellene dine.
Konklusjon
I denne veiledningen har vi gått gjennom fire forskjellige tilnærminger for å fjerne de første 3 tegnene fra cellene i excel. Du er hjertelig velkommen til å kommentere hvis du har spørsmål eller spørsmål. Gi tilbakemelding i kommentarfeltet. Takk for besøket i ExcelWIKI. Fortsett å lære!